總結:ABSTRACT: Currently, technology advances with leaps and bounds, which is why educational institutions challenge the change in the methodology of the teaching-learning process with the new modality of study, virtuality, where Mobile Learning is defined as mobile learning through which The teacher can make use of this methodology in the classroom for a synchronous class through the use of a cell phone, thus facilitating the development of skills and abilities in the student. The study's objective was to design e-activities based on Mobile learning for the interaction in synchronous classes of the subject of computer science in the first year of high school students of the Mariscal Sucre Educational Unit. The methodology used was quantitative. The sample consisted of 50 students. The survey was applied as a technique of closed questions according to the Likert scale. As a result, it was found that teachers needed to use technological tools to teach. Through this study, it was possible to conclude, among the topics investigated, that M-learning offers new methods of education where technologies support teaching, which allows instructors and students to be physically separated, favoring a set of possibilities associated with new mobile technologies and wireless communication networks, generating a greater degree of mobility and flexibility either by the student or by the teacher.
